What’s your name again?

People must really like one another’s bodies.
In a late night with too many cheap drinks,
Too much dancing and too many people,
It seems too easy to let go of your personality
And just become a body with a head of hormones.
No bantering, talking, “getting to know” or personalizing
The person who you’re flirting, kissing, touching,
Becoming personal.

There isn’t a word for the men and women who do this;
Who start with the physical and later find out
The mental. A college profressor said
“Nowadays, kids will have sex, then they may date.”
I say, “They’re just going back to their roots, getting instinctual.”

It’s easy to lose a name when you see his crotch and gasp;
It’s easy to lose a name when you are staring at her ass.
Mating before Dating.
